Data: Bitcoin's market share has reached 45.84%, indicating that traders are flocking to Bitcoin

2023-06-15 21:04:20

ChainCatcher news, according to The Block, Bitcoin Dominance has reached 45.84%, a nearly 2-year high.

It is reported that the last time such a level was seen was in July 2021, when it reached 46.77%. This indicates that traders and investors are flocking to Bitcoin rather than smaller market share altcoins. (Source link)
